This is an official report of an unannounced visit/investigation of a complaint received in our office on

11/13/2023 and conducted by Evaluator David Leibert

COMPLAINT CONTROL NUMBER: 21-AS-20231113155356

Staff did not seek timely medical care for client

Licensing Program Analyst Leibert arrives unannounced for the purpose of delivering findings on this complaint. During the course of this investigation, statements were taken from staff and witnesses, documents were obtained and reviewed as well as site visits made to the facility which included inspections of the kitchen and the food supply and service. Photo's of clients' lunches were obtained. The following determinations are made: Although one client appears to have a sensitivity to cheese, no client in care has a modified diet ordered by a physician or dietician; On 11/03/2023, client (C1) fell at day program and sustained an injury requiring medical intervention; On 11/01/2023, program staff notified facility that C1 was limping at program; Program staff allege that C1 continued to limp on 11/02 while at Program; Facility staff state they were not notified of the continuing limping by C1 and that C1 did not limp when at the facility prior to C1's fall. Although the allegations may be true, based on the statements and documents, there is not a preponderance of evidence to prove the allegations true or, not true. Therefore, the allegations are UNSUBSTANTIATED.
